Do not eat too much before you head in to your appointment. While you should not go in on an empty stomach, because you could experience nausea if you do, stuffing yourself will only make you feel bad. Instead, plan to have a snack about an hour or two before your appointment time.

Do not expect to leave your first appointment feeling one-hundred percent better. Like many treatments, it will take a few visits before you reach full levels of restoration. Be patient and give the treatment a chance before you call it quits. You will be happy you gave it enough time.

It is important that your acupuncturist is licensed by your State Health Department. Then you will know that your acupuncturist has attended a full complement of courses and been tested and properly licensed rather than taking an online course or something from the back of a magazine. You can be sure that they know what they're doing.

Do you need your daily caffeine fix? If you have an acupuncture session scheduled, you may want to hold off on the coffee for a little while. Because coffee is a stimulant, it will raise sympathetic nerve activity. Acupuncture strives to do the opposite. You don't want to work against yourself!

Avoid wearing tight fitting clothing when you go to your acupuncture appointment. Both you and the acupuncturist will benefit if your clothing is looser. It is easier for your acupuncturist to place needles without struggling with your tight clothes. Some sessions also involve group environments where you need clothes to stay on, so keep them loose.

See if your practitioner accepts your insurance coverage. Acupuncture can cost you quite a bit of money, especially if you have to go do them on a regular basis. If you decide that you're going to make acupuncture a part of your life, shop around for an insurance policy that will cover the treatments you need.

Do you enjoy working out? If so, you may struggle to avoid working out on your acupuncture days. It's acceptable to continue your workouts, but try to complete it with less intensity. For example, try walking instead of running. You should never perform extreme exercise on acupuncture days because this can reduce their effectiveness.

You may love to have a glass of wine with dinner, but it's best to stay away from alcohol on the day of an acupuncture session. Alcohol is dehydrating, and even a small amount of alcohol can impair your senses. After you've had acupuncture, you want your body to be hydrated and your mind to be clear.

If you are looking for an acupuncturist near you, try asking around for recommendations. You can ask friends, family, coworkers, etc. If any of them get acupuncture treatments or have in the past, try asking them who did it, what it was like and if they would recommend them to you. It is usually better to get acupuncturist referrals from people you trust than calling about someone in a printed ad.

Inquire about how long your treatment will take. Once you're done with your appointment, you need to remain relaxed and you cannot do this if you have not scheduled appropriately. Schedule your day accordingly.

Schedule your acupuncture treatments carefully. You should not get an acupuncture treatment between two other obligations or after a strenuous activity. Take a few hours to relax before your appointment and make sure you have plenty of free time afterward so you do not feel too stressed during your treatment.

Make sure you request to see official credentials prior to accepting any form of acupuncture treatment. Just like in other areas of heath care, there are some less than reputable forces at work that are just looking to take your money. If the practitioner has no credentials, look to someone else for your care.
